About the Author

Betsy TaylorBetsy Taylor

BETSY TAYLOR is the founder and President of the Center for a New American Dream, a non-profit group that helps Americans resist excessive commercialism and consume wisely to protect the environment, improve quality of life, and enhance social justice. She has a masters degree in public administration from Harvard University and graduated summa cum laude with a BA from Duke University.
